The LTC3728EUH#PBF operates as a step-down DC-DC converter. It uses a switching regulator topology to efficiently convert the input voltage to the desired output voltage. The IC controls the switching of power MOSFETs to regulate the output voltage based on feedback signals. Various protection mechanisms, such as current limit and thermal shutdown, ensure safe and reliable operation.
